Fundamentals of modern Database Management 
Systems (DBMSs): storage, indexing, query 
optimization, transaction processing, concurrency 
and recovery. Fundamentals of Distributed DBMSs, 
Web Databases and Cloud Databases (NoSQL / 
NewSQL): Semi-structured data management (XML/
JSON, XPath and XQuery), Document data-stores 
(i.e., CouchDB, MongoDB, RavenDB), Key-Value 
data-stores (e.g., BerkeleyDB, MemCached), 
Introduction to Cloud Computing (NFS, GFS/
Hadoop HDFS, Replication/Consistency Principles), 
Big-data processing/analytic frameworks (Apache 
MapReduce/PIG, Spark/Shark), Column-stores 
(e.g., Google’s BigTable, Apache’s HBase, Apache’s 
Cassandra), Graph databases (e.g., Twitter. 
FlockDB) and Overview of NewSQL (Google’s 
Spanner/F1). Spatio-temporal data management 
(trajectories, privacy, analytics) and index structures 
(e.g., R-Trees, Grid Files) as well as other selected 
and advanced topics, including: Embeeded 
Databases (sqlite), Sensor / Smartphone / Crowd 
data management, Energy-aware data management, 
Flash storage, Stream Data Management, etc.
